Krashen’s TheoryAs an expert in the field of linguistics, Stephen Krashen used his expertise to develop theories of language acquisition and development. One of his theories, which is known as Krashen’s Theory of Second Language Acquisition, has had a significant effect in areas relating to research and learning second language (Schutz, 2019). The theory comprises five components, which are primarily hypotheses that establish the principles of acquisition of second language (Koceva, 2018). The first component of Krashen’s Theory is the acquisition-learning hypothesis, which comprises the acquired system and the learned system. While the acquired system is the outcome of a subconscious process while the learning system is the by-product of formal instruction. An elementary teacher can incorporate this component by including material-texts like pictures that help illustrate what he/she is teaching. The monitor hypothesis is the second component and it explains the link between acquisition and learning as well as define learning in terms of acquisition. This component can be incorporated in elementary classrooms by acting as a sympathetic listener of all students and offering repetitions (Patrick, 2019).

The final component of this theory is the affective filter hypothesis, which postulates that variables like self-confidence, motivation, personality traits, and anxiety play a facilitative role in language acquisition (Tricomi, 2007). An elementary teacher can incorporate this in the classroom by using suggestopedia techniques.
